Output 2ec32fcafa906a8b4b373b7e83145ef7879f7efb9352a7f739ab47e31d1e4044:0

value
3497190
script pubkey
OP_0 OP_PUSHBYTES_20 de5e828284e41ad1b0300f20c89413699b385b64
address
bc1qme0g9q5yusddrvpspusv39qndxdnskmyu3h33u
transaction
2ec32fcafa906a8b4b373b7e83145ef7879f7efb9352a7f739ab47e31d1e4044